Description of Services:
FOOD SAFETY: This program reduces the incidence of foodborne illness (food poisoning) in Peterborough City and Count. There are close to 1000 food premises in Peterborough City and County, including restaurants, supermarkets, butcher shops, and chip trucks as well as cafeterias and kitchens located in churches, daycares and long-term care facilities.
SAFE WATER: Public health Units in Ontario are required to routinely inspect public swimming pools and spas to ensure that they comply with standards and regulation designed to protect clients from infectious disease, physical injury and drowning hazards. Additional inspections are conducted as necessary to follow up on directions provided to operators during routine inspections, and to respond to complaints.
HEALTH HAZARD INVESTIGATION: Investigation of public health hazard complaints, residential air quality concerns, and clusters of non-communicable diseases.
